2017-09-06 3 views
0

J'ai créé une page calendrier complet dans la force de vente. Maintenant, je voudrais ajouter une div lorsque je passe un vol sur un événement. Iit travaille mais div caché en dessous d'un autre événement et je veux le montrer sur tout ce qui précède.Afficher ma division ci-dessus un autre div

eventMouseover: function(calEvent, domEvent) { 
        console.log(calEvent.id); 
        console.log(domEvent); 
        $(this).append('<div id="events-layer" style="background-color:white;z-index:99999; overflow-auto;background-repeat: no-repeat;background-position: center;position: absolute;">'+'<table class="tableContent" cellpadding="5"> <tr class="tablerow"> <td class="tablerdata">Event Detail:</td> <td class="tablerdata"> <button type="button" onclick="myFunction()">Delete</button> <button type="button">edit</button> </td> <td>&nbsp;</td> </tr> <tr class="tablerow"> <td class="tablerdata">Assigned To </td> <td class="MiddleCol">fffffffffffffffffff</td> <td class="MiddleCol">Griffin</td> </tr> <tr class="tablerow"> <td class="tablerdata">Subject</td> <td class="MiddleCol">Griffin</td> <td class="MiddleCol">Griffin</td> </tr> <tr class="tablerow"> <td class="tablerdata">Start </td> <td class="MiddleCol">Griffin</td> <td class="MiddleCol">Griffin</td> </tr> <tr class="tablerow"> <td class="tablerdata">End </td> <td class="MiddleCol">Griffin</td> <td class="MiddleCol">Griffffffffin</td> </tr> <tr class="tablerow"> <td class="tablerdata">Related To </td> <td class="MiddleCol">Griffin</td> <td class="MiddleCol">Griffin</td> </tr> <tr class="tablerow"> <td class="tablerdata">Name </td> <td class="MiddleCol">Griffin</td> <td class="MiddleCol">Griffin</td> </tr> </table>'+'</div>'); 
       } 
+0

'append' met le nouvel élément comme le dernier enfant de l'élément cible. Avez-vous essayé 'prepend' à la place? – ADyson

Répondre

0

Essayez de faire la position de l'élément contenant « relatif »